而且同一个手机似乎在不同时刻,有时候正常,有时候不正常,比如我的手机,ios15.6.1,微信版本8.0.31,最开始能正常缓存,第二次秒开,后面有一段时间不能缓存,最近又正常了。不知道是和什么有关造成的影响。
webview引入的地址所加载的静态资源在部分机型没有被304协商缓存?webview引入的是一个单页应用,单页应用本身js就比较庞大,于是ng设置了协商缓存。然后部分机型(ios、安卓都有)在第二次加载的时候还是很慢,查了日志发现是很慢的这些手机http 304没有起作用,request headers没有带If-None-Match过去,e-tag是返回了的。 然后用所有pc主流浏览器和所有出问题的手机的自带浏览器都测试加载了这个单页应用,发现所有浏览器都能正常,能够正确协商缓存,包括微信聊天里打开的内置浏览器都没有问题,唯独webview出问题。 -Match
2023-01-10才遇到这个问题,做倒计时的时候。。 最后用setTimeOut进行递归处理模拟setInterVal就没问题了。
安卓机在页面上下重复滑动造成定时器暂停现象安卓机在页面上下重复滑动造成定时器暂停, 随便写一个定时器都会出现,而且页面上下滑动时间越长这个暂停时间也会越长,中间滑动时间也没有被计算进去,甚至严重的会造成定时器直接停止,必须要再次上下滑动页面才能是定时器再次起作用。随便写一个定时器都会出现
2018-12-20[图片] 这张是生成后的图片 [图片] 这张是canvas的,可以看到是透明的。
canvasToTempFilePath有办法生成圆角图片吗我用canvas生成了一个这个黑色圆角矩形,canvas上面看到是正常的,没有这个白底,但是用canvasToTempFilePath生成一张图片后,这个图片自带有白色背景底色,可以去掉他吗 [图片]
2018-12-19